Web7 de mai. de 2024 · The first shock incorporates shocks to crude oil production associated with exogenous geopolitical events in oil-producing countries, as well as unexpected supply decisions by OPEC producers and other oil supply shocks, defined as flow supply shock. WebFirst, an oil supply shock moves oil prices and oil production in opposite directions. Such shocks could, for instance, be the result of production disruptions caused by military conflicts or changes in the production quotas set by the Organization of the Petroleum Exporting Countries (OPEC). WebThe 1990 oil price shock occurred in response to the Iraqi invasion of Kuwait on August 2, 1990, Saddam Hussein's second invasion of a fellow OPEC member. Web3 de jan. de 2024 · In October ‘73, OPEC raised its price by 70 percent to $5.11 per barrel while many of its members also began cutting production by 5 percent per month. Matters came to a head on 22 December, ‘73, when OPEC announced it would be unilaterally raising the price of crude oil to $7 per barrel.
